<html><head><meta http-equiv="Content-Type" content="text/html charset=utf-8"></head><body style="word-wrap: break-word; -webkit-nbsp-mode: space; -webkit-line-break: after-white-space;" class="">Hi folks —<br class=""><div><font color="#5856d6" class=""><br class=""></font>I’m having problems with playing back recordings on Mythtv 0.27 (running on Gentoo; tuner is an HD Home Run). A couple of minutes into a recording, playback will abruptly halt. Judging from the file size of the recording, and also the log output, this is occurring well before the actual end of the recording.<br class=""><font color="#5856d6" class=""><br class=""></font>Here’s the relevant (I think) portion of the frontend logfile:<br class=""><font color="#5856d6" class=""><br class=""></font>2014-11-10 08:02:23.330317 I Player(0): FPS: 30.01 Mean: 33327 Std.Dev: 197 CPUs: 16% 45% <br class="">2014-11-10 08:02:27.296933 I Player(0): FPS: 30.00 Mean: 33327 Std.Dev: 221 CPUs: 14% 49% <br class="">2014-11-10 08:02:31.263549 I Player(0): FPS: 30.01 Mean: 33327 Std.Dev: 212 CPUs: 13% 45% <br class="">2014-11-10 08:02:34.078375 E decoding error<br class=""> eno: Unknown error 541478725 (541478725)<br class="">2014-11-10 08:02:34.146823 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.213548 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.280240 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.346866 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.347021 I Player(0): 6400 interlaced frames seen.<br class="">2014-11-10 08:02:34.413562 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.480190 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.546924 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.613606 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.680221 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.746944 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.813477 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.880200 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:34.946938 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.013555 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.096901 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.163571 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.230265 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.296893 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.363587 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.430274 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.496866 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.563609 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.630218 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.696870 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.763539 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.830201 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.896868 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:35.963518 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:36.030205 I Player(0): Video is 30 frames ahead of audio,<br class=""> doubling video frame interval to slow down.<br class="">2014-11-10 08:02:36.030339 I waiting for no video frames 0<br class="">2014-11-10 08:02:36.030355 I HasReachedEof() at framesPlayed=6422 totalFrames=55644<br class="">2014-11-10 08:02:36.078560 I Player(0): Play speed: rate: 29.97 speed: 0 skip: 0 => new interval 33366<br class="">2014-11-10 08:02:36.095356 E decoding error<br class=""> eno: Unknown error 541478725 (541478725)<br class="">2014-11-10 08:02:36.112141 I VideoOutputXv: UpdatePauseFrame() AAAAAAfAALAAAAAAAAAAAAFuAAAAAAAP<br class="">2014-11-10 08:02:36.129564 I TV: HandleStateChange(0) -- begin<br class="">2014-11-10 08:02:36.129601 I TV: Attempting to change from WatchingPreRecorded to None<br class="">2014-11-10 08:02:36.129633 I TV: StopStuff() for player ctx 0 -- begin<br class="">2014-11-10 08:02:36.129653 I TV: SetActive(0,w/o OSD) 0 -> 0 -- begin<br class="">2014-11-10 08:02:36.129701 I TV: SetActive(0,w/o OSD) 0 -> 0 -- end<br class="">2014-11-10 08:02:36.129719 I Player(0): StopPlaying - begin<br class="">2014-11-10 08:02:36.131690 I Player(0): Decoder thread exiting.<br class="">2014-11-10 08:02:36.131898 I Player(0): Exited decoder loop.<br class="">2014-11-10 08:02:36.134487 I VideoOutputXv: dtor<br class="">2014-11-10 08:02:36.134524 I VideoOutputXv: DiscardFrames(1)<br class="">2014-11-10 08:02:36.134599 I VideoBuffers::DiscardFrames(1): AAAAAAFAAAAAAAAAAAAAAAFUAAAAAAAP<br class="">2014-11-10 08:02:36.134655 I VideoBuffers::DiscardFrames(1): A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AP -- done<br class="">2014-11-10 08:02:36.134697 I VideoOutputXv: DiscardFrames() 3: A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AP -- done()<br class="">2014-11-10 08:02:36.141554 I VideoOutputXv: Closing XVideo port 72<br class="">2014-11-10 08:02:36.141604 I Setup Interrupt handler<br class="">2014-11-10 08:02:36.141616 I Setup Terminated handler<br class="">2014-11-10 08:02:36.204467 I Player(0): StopPlaying - end<br class="">2014-11-10 08:02:36.204487 I TV: StopStuff(): stopping ring buffer<br class="">2014-11-10 08:02:36.204520 I TV: StopStuff(): stopping player<br class="">2014-11-10 08:02:36.204527 I TV: StopStuff() -- end<br class="">2014-11-10 08:02:36.204569 I TV: Changing from WatchingPreRecorded to None<br class="">2014-11-10 08:02:36.204593 I TV: HandleStateChange(0) -- end<br class="">2014-11-10 08:02:36.204627 I TV: Exiting main playback loop.<br class="">2014-11-10 08:02:36.204639 I TV: StartTV -- process events 2 begin<br class="">2014-11-10 08:02:36.205431 I TV: StartTV -- process events 2 end<br class="">2014-11-10 08:02:36.205449 I TV::~TV() -- begin<br class="">2014-11-10 08:02:36.238591 I TV::~TV() -- lock<br class="">2014-11-10 08:02:36.238799 I Player(0): StopPlaying - begin<br class="">2014-11-10 08:02:36.238826 I Player(0): Exited decoder loop.<br class="">2014-11-10 08:02:36.238840 I Player(0): StopPlaying - end<br class="">2014-11-10 08:02:36.250036 I TV::~TV() -- end<br class="">2014-11-10 08:02:36.250242 N Resuming idle timer<br class="">2014-11-10 08:02:36.250399 I TV: StartTV -- end<br class=""><font color="#5856d6" class=""><br class=""></font>The point at which the playback ceased is during a commercial break, and could be at the end of the break. Is this a commflag issue? If so, how do I resolve?<br class=""><font color="#5856d6" class=""><br class=""></font>cheers,<br class=""><font color="#5856d6" class=""><br class=""></font>Rich<br class=""><font color="#5856d6" class=""><br class=""><br class=""><br class=""></font><blockquote type="cite" class=""><div class=""><br class=""></div></blockquote></div><br class=""></body></html>